OK. So it sounds like none of you guys (above) have actually PLAYED the game. So, my impressions... I think the game is very reminiscent of an old GBA title. I'm not saying it's actually like any game out there, but more the quality of the game (sound, gameplay, etc.) As far as the actual gameplay goes, the tutorial is helpful, but once you actually play the game you see that the game is really nothing like the tutorial, its linking on an ENORMOUS scale. The goal of the game is to link different colors of four sided "satellites" together so each color is facing a corresponding similar color, and you create chains and repair broken satellites as you go on. Because of the enormous scale of the linking, this makes the game rather difficult and serious puzzler fans might like it. On the whole, I think this game deserves a 6/10, because it's really nothing new, and what it does, it does so-so. As a puzzler fan, I think more could have been done to make this a greater game, with slicker graphics, sound, etc. That's just my opinion, though. Anyone else out there play it yet?
